139. To ask the Taoiseach if he will provide a breakdown of money that has already been spent by the shared island unit on projects under its remit, by year, to date. [24039/23]

Photo of Peadar TóibínPeadar Tóibín (Meath West, Aontú)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

140. To ask the Taoiseach if he will provide a breakdown of the money that has already been spent by the shared island unit in each jurisdiction on projects under its remit, by year, to date. [24041/23]

Photo of Leo VaradkarLeo Varadkar (Dublin West, Fine Gael)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

I propose to take Questions Nos. 139 and 140 together.

Expenditure incurred directly by the Shared Island unit, the Department of the Taoiseach, relates primarily to the Shared Island research programme and dialogue series. Expenditure by year to date is set out in tabular form below.

This administrative expenditure by the unit is mainly in this jurisdiction, with the research programme work typically involving North/South or East/West research collaboration. Furthermore, two of the Shared Island dialogue events were convened in Northern Ireland to date.

Concerning the bulk of the Shared Island Fund expenditure, following Government decisions on allocations, individual projects are then taken forward by the relevant Government Ministers and Department. Fund allocations are made to and managed within Departmental Votes. In many cases, projects are progressed with funding from a number of sources, including Departmental or Agency resources, and/or with contributions from counterparts in Northern Ireland, the UK Government, or by Local Authority partners.

A full list of Shared Island Fund allocations is also provided in tabular form below.

Shared Island unit expenditure(Costs related to the Shared Island unit are covered within the administrative budget for the Department of the Taoiseach, as set out in the published Revised Estimates Volume each year.)
2023 (January-April)*
Research programme €4,080.00
Dialogue series €929.88
Admin (office equipment, IT, postal and telecommunications, travel and subsistence) €10,503.63
2023* - payments pending for research and dialogue activity to date €15,513.51
2022
Research programme (including with Economic and Social Research Institute, National Economic and Social Council, Irish Research Council, Standing Conference on Teacher Education North and South) €620,000.00
Dialogue series (of which €44,999.51 was for dialogue events held in Northern Ireland) €211,845.69
Admin (office equipment, IT, postal and telecommunications, travel and subsistence) €29,557.46
2022 total €861,403.15
2021
Research programme (including with Economic and Social Research Institute, National Economic and Social Council, Irish Research Council, Standing Conference on Teacher Education North and South) €344,520.25
Dialogue series (held online given public health requirements) €50,414.70
Admin (office equipment and IT, postal and telecommunications, travel and subsistence) €10,360.14
2021 total €405,295.09
2020
Research programme €0.00
Dialogue series (held online given public health requirements) €17,813.80
Admin (office equipment and IT, postal and telecommunications, travel and subsistence) €18,290.03
2020 total €36,103.83

Shared Island Fund allocations (€m) as at May 2023
Phases 2 and 3 of the Ulster Canal restoration contribution - €47m

Taken forward by the Minister for Housing, Local Government and Heritage
Bringing the Narrow Water Bridge project to tender stage - €3m

Taken forward by the Minister for Housing, Local Government and Heritage
North South Research Programme contribution (funding rounds 1 and 2, 2022-2027) - €50m

Taken forward by the Minister for Further and Higher Education, Research, Innovation and Science
All-Island Co-Centres for Research and Innovation contribution - €20m

Taken forward by the Minister for Further and Higher Education, Research, Innovation and Science
Electric Vehicle charging point scheme for Sports Clubs across the island - €15m

Taken forward by the Minister for Transport
Shared Island dimension to Community Climate Action Programme - €3m

Taken forward by the Minister for Environment, Climate and Communications
Shared Island Local Authority development funding scheme - €5m

Taken forward by the Minister for Housing, Local Government and Heritage
All-island biodiversity actions on peatlands restoration and biosecurity - €11m

Taken forward by the Minister for Housing, Local Government and Heritage
Shared Island Civic Society Fund contribution - €2m

Taken forward by the Tánaiste and Minister for Foreign Affairs
Shared Island dimension to Creative Ireland and cultural heritage projects - €8m

Taken forward by the Minister for Tourism, Culture, Arts, Gaeltacht, Sport and Media
All-Island arts capital investment projects - €7.4m

Taken forward by the Minister for Tourism, Culture, Arts, Gaeltacht, Sport and Media
Cross-border tourism brand collaboration and marketing initiative - €7.6m

Taken forward by the Minister for Tourism, Culture, Arts, Gaeltacht, Sport and Media
Cross-border innovation hub - €12m

Taken forward by the Minister for Housing, Local Government and Heritage
